Passive infrastructure: poles, ducts, and towers

Passive infrastructure refers to the non-electronic components required to support telecommunications networks, including poles, ducts, and towers. These structures serve as fundamental platforms that enable network deployment and maintenance. Their management is often governed by telecommunications infrastructure sharing laws to optimize usage.

Poles are vertical structures used mainly for mounting cables, antennas, and other equipment in urban and rural environments. Ducts are conduits that house fiber optic cables and other wiring, protecting them from environmental damage and facilitating easier upgrades or repairs. Towers, whether guyed, lattice, or monopole, provide elevated positions essential for wireless transmissions and signal clarity.

Telecommunications infrastructure sharing laws regulate access to these passive assets, promoting efficient use of scarce space and reducing deployment costs. By sharing poles, ducts, and towers, network operators can accelerate infrastructure rollout while minimizing environmental and visual impacts. These laws also set standards to ensure safety, reliability, and equitable access for all parties involved.

Dispute resolution mechanisms

Dispute resolution mechanisms within telecommunications infrastructure sharing laws are essential for maintaining industry stability and fair practices. They provide structured channels to resolve conflicts efficiently, minimizing disruptions to ongoing services and infrastructure development.

Common mechanisms include negotiation, mediation, arbitration, and litigation. Negotiation encourages direct communication between parties to reach mutual agreements, while mediation involves a neutral third party facilitating dialogue to find common ground. Arbitration offers a binding decision from an impartial arbiter, and litigation entails formal court proceedings.

These mechanisms are typically outlined in the legal framework governing infrastructure sharing laws. They aim to promote timely, transparent, and cost-effective dispute resolution. Clear procedures help prevent prolonged legal battles and promote continued cooperation among infrastructure providers and network operators.

Challenges and Controversies in Implementing Sharing Laws

Implementing telecommunications infrastructure sharing laws presents several challenges that affect effective regulation. One significant issue is balancing the interests of infrastructure providers and network operators. Providers may resist sharing due to concerns over revenue loss or competitive advantage.

Enforcing legal frameworks can also be complex, especially when infrastructure overlaps with existing property rights and rights of way. Disputes often arise regarding access and usage, requiring clear and consistent access regulations. Such conflicts can lead to prolonged legal battles, delaying infrastructure rollout.

Furthermore, technological and geographic disparities complicate law enforcement. Rural areas, for example, may lack sufficient infrastructure, making sharing laws less practical or harder to enforce effectively. This uneven implementation can undermine the intended benefits of infrastructure sharing laws.

Finally, controversies surrounding transparency and fairness persist. Critics argue that certain laws may favor dominant market players, stifling competition or innovation. Ensuring equitable access and regulation remains an ongoing challenge in the legal landscape of telecommunications infrastructure sharing laws.
